3-D Video Formats and Coding- A review
Journal Title: International Journal of Engineering and Science Invention - Year 2017, Vol 6, Issue 2
Abstract
The objective of a video communication system is to deliver the maximum of video data from the source to the destination through a communication channel using all of its available bandwidth. To achieve this objective, the source coding should compress the original video sequence as much as possible and the compressed video data should be robust and resilient to channel errors. However, while achieving a high coding efficiency, compression also makes the coded video bitstream vulnerable to transmission errors. Thus, the process of video data compression tends to work against the objectives of robustness and resilience to errors. Therefore, extra information that needs to be transmitted in 3-D video has brought new challenge and consumer applications will not gain more popularity unless the 3-D video coding problems are addressed.
